Annotated Information

Function

The gene locus Os02g0535400 is a gene called Os RAR1(NCBI Gene ID: 4329567) and this gene codes a protein called Cysteine and histidine-rich domain-containing protein RAR1( NCBI ACCESSION:Q6EPW7)[1]. RAR1 (for required for Mla12 resistance) is an important component of R gene–mediated disease resistance, which contains two zinc binding finger motifs termed CHORD-I and CHORD-II (Cys- and His-rich domains). In plants, RAR1 interacts directly with SGT1 (for suppressor of the G2 allele of skp1) and HSP90. The CHORD-I domain of RAR1 interacts directly with the N terminus of HSP90, and SGT1 binds the CHORD-II domain of RAR1. SGT1 is required for disease resistance mediated by diverse R proteins and is also required for the function of an SCF (for Skp1/Cullin/F-box protein). RAR1, SGT1, and HSP90 were shown to play an important role in regulating the stability of R proteins that contain the NBS-LRR domain[1]. RAR1 is an important component in innate immunity in Rice. RAR1 is required for basal resistance against compatible races of rice blast and bacterial blight and this resistance is mediated by Os Rac1. Interestingly, Os RAR1is not required by the three examined riceRgenes for blast resistance. Recently, it was shown that OsRAR1is not required for Pish-mediated blast resistance[2]. RAR1 is critical for Os Rac1–mediated enhancement of PAMP signaling. Therefore, RAR1 activity in rice innate immunity may be on a broader scale than in those other species.
